#52e6c5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#52e6c5 is composed of 32.2% red, 90.2%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.3%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 166.6 degrees, a saturation of 74.7% and a lightness of 61.2%. #52e6c5 color hex could be obtained by blending #a4ffff with #00cd8b.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#52e6c5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#52e6c5 has RGB values of R:82, G:230,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0, Y:0.14,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 5433029.
